A Servant of the Mosque, A Patient of Grace: Tahir Muhammad’s Story
Tahir Muhammad has devoted his life to serving his local mosque as its caretaker and supervisor — a role he has held with quiet dedication for many years. But in 2011, life handed him an additional challenge: a diagnosis of diabetes. Managing the condition brought not only physical strain, but a financial burden that weighed heavily on a man of modest means. Insulin, regular medication, and ongoing monitoring all come at a cost that was difficult to sustain. Then, through word of mouth in his community, Tahir heard about the Yashfeen Trust Free Diabetic Centre. In 2018, he visited for the first time — and it changed everything.
